Python自动化办公教程_从基础到实践

版权申诉
5星 · 超过95%的资源 1 下载量 181 浏览量 更新于2024-11-26 收藏 11.05MB ZIP 举报
资源摘要信息:"Python自动化办公详细教程,适合python小白" 知识点: 1. Python基础: Python是一种广泛使用的高级编程语言,其设计哲学强调代码的可读性和简洁的语法(尤其是使用空格缩进来区分代码块,而不是使用大括号或关键字)。Python支持多种编程范式,包括面向对象、命令式、函数式和过程式编程。Python的基础知识是学习自动化办公的基础,包括变量、数据类型、控制流程(如if语句、循环)以及函数的定义和使用。 2. Excel操作: 在办公自动化中,经常需要操作Excel文件。Python通过openpyxl、xlrd、xlwt等库来处理Excel文件。例如,使用openpyxl库可以读取Excel文件中的数据,修改数据,甚至创建新的Excel文件。此外,还可以利用csv模块对csv文件进行操作,比如在csv文件中写入数据。 3. 自动化办公: 自动化办公是使用计算机程序或脚本来完成日常工作中重复性高、标准化的任务,从而提高工作效率,减少人为错误。Python因其简洁易读的语言特性,成为了实现自动化办公的热门选择。Python提供的丰富库支持,可以轻松实现文件管理、数据分析、网络爬虫、报表生成等多种办公自动化任务。 4. openpyxl库的使用: openpyxl是一个Python库,用于读写Excel 2010 xlsx/xlsm/xltx/xltm文件。它是一个完全用Python编写的库,不需要安装Microsoft Excel。openpyxl使得Python自动化办公处理Excel变得更加容易,例如打开一个Excel文件、创建新的工作表、读取或写入单元格数据、修改工作表样式等。 5. csv文件操作: CSV文件是纯文本文件,其中包含了由逗号分隔的值(因此得名"Comma-Separated Values")。在Python中,csv模块提供了一种读取和写入CSV文件的方法。可以使用csv模块将数据写入到csv文件中,每一行代表一组数据,字段之间用逗号分隔。 6. 本教程适用人群: 此教程特别适合对Python编程零基础的小白用户。通过本教程,用户可以逐步了解Python的基础语法,学会如何用Python进行办公自动化操作,从而提高工作效率,减少重复劳动。教程内容详细,循序渐进,结合实际案例,帮助初学者轻松上手。 7. 教程结构: 本教程共分为五个部分,分别对应五个学习笔记文件(第一关至第四关学习笔记.pdf和openpyxl常用用法查询手册.pdf)。每个文件都包含了对应关卡的学习重点和实操内容,用户可以通过系统学习这些文件来掌握Python自动化办公的技能。